How To Integrate AI Prompts into Messaging Services for Enhanced User Engagement

How To Integrate AI Prompts into Messaging Services for Enhanced User Engagement
messaging services with ai prompts

In the fast-paced world of digital communication, user engagement is a metric of paramount importance. Messaging services have evolved from simple text exchanges to rich platforms supporting images, videos, and now, artificial intelligence (AI). The integration of AI prompts into messaging services represents a significant leap in enhancing user engagement. In this article, we will explore the nuances of this integration, leveraging tools like AI Gateway, LLM Gateway, and OpenAPIs, and how APIPark can streamline this process.

Introduction to AI Prompts in Messaging

AI prompts are predefined inputs or suggestions that guide the AI model to generate relevant outputs. These prompts can range from simple text completion to complex multi-turn conversations. Integrating AI prompts into messaging services can revolutionize how users interact with these platforms by providing more personalized, context-aware responses.

Why Integrate AI Prompts?

  1. Personalization: AI prompts can tailor the conversation to the user's preferences, history, and context, making interactions more engaging.
  2. Efficiency: By automating responses, AI prompts can handle high volumes of messages without compromising on quality.
  3. Scalability: As businesses grow, AI prompts can scale to manage increased traffic without the need for additional human resources.

Understanding the Building Blocks: AI Gateway, LLM Gateway, and OpenAPI

AI Gateway

An AI Gateway serves as a middleware that connects various AI services and models to the user interface. It abstracts the complexity of interacting with different AI models, providing a unified interface for developers.

  • Key Features:
  • Interoperability: Connects multiple AI models and services.
  • Security: Ensures secure communication between services.
  • Scalability: Manages increased loads efficiently.

LLM Gateway

A Language Model (LLM) Gateway is a specialized form of AI Gateway that focuses on natural language processing (NLP) tasks. It leverages large language models to generate human-like text responses.

  • Key Features:
  • Contextual Understanding: Processes and responds to natural language inputs.
  • Customization: Allows fine-tuning of models for specific use cases.
  • Performance: Delivers fast responses even under heavy loads.

OpenAPI

OpenAPI is a standard for defining and describing RESTful APIs. It allows developers to create, document, and test APIs in a standardized way.

  • Key Features:
  • Standardization: Provides a common language for API design.
  • Interoperability: Ensures APIs can be easily consumed by different systems.
  • Documentation: Automates the generation of API documentation.

Integrating AI Prompts into Messaging Services

The integration process involves several steps, from selecting the right AI models to implementing them within the messaging service. Here’s a step-by-step guide:

Step 1: Selecting the AI Models

The first step is to choose the AI models that best fit the messaging service's needs. This could involve natural language understanding (NLU) models for interpreting user inputs, generative models for creating responses, or even specialized models for specific tasks like sentiment analysis.

Step 2: Setting Up the AI Gateway

Once the models are selected, the next step is to set up the AI Gateway. This involves configuring the gateway to connect to the chosen AI models and ensuring it can handle the expected load.

  • Configuration Tips:
  • API Endpoints: Define clear endpoints for each AI model.
  • Security: Implement authentication and authorization mechanisms.
  • Monitoring: Set up logging and monitoring to track performance and usage.

Step 3: Implementing OpenAPI

To facilitate easy integration with the messaging service, it’s essential to use OpenAPI to define the API interfaces. This ensures that any changes to the AI models or prompts do not impact the application code.

  • OpenAPI Benefits:
  • Documentation: Automatically generates documentation for the API.
  • Validation: Ensures that the API requests and responses are valid.
  • Interoperability: Allows the API to be consumed by different systems and programming languages.

Step 4: Integrating with the Messaging Service

The final step is to integrate the AI Gateway with the messaging service. This involves modifying the service to send user inputs to the AI Gateway and display the AI-generated responses.

  • Integration Tips:
  • Real-time Feedback: Implement mechanisms for real-time feedback to the user.
  • Fallback Strategies: Define fallback strategies for cases where the AI model fails to generate a valid response.
  • User Experience: Ensure the integration enhances the user experience without being intrusive.

Case Study: Implementing AI Prompts in a Customer Support Chatbot

Let’s take a closer look at how a hypothetical company, ChatBotCo, implemented AI prompts into their customer support chatbot using APIPark.

Background

ChatBotCo provides a customer support chatbot for an e-commerce platform. The chatbot handles a variety of queries, from order status checks to product recommendations. However, the chatbot struggled with providing personalized and context-aware responses.

Solution

ChatBotCo decided to integrate AI prompts into their chatbot using APIPark’s AI Gateway and OpenAPI.

  • AI Models: They selected a natural language understanding (NLU) model to interpret user queries and a generative model to create personalized responses.
  • AI Gateway: The AI Gateway was configured to connect to these models and handle the expected load during peak times.
  • OpenAPI: The API interfaces were defined using OpenAPI, ensuring that any changes to the AI models or prompts did not affect the chatbot’s code.
  • Integration: The chatbot was modified to send user inputs to the AI Gateway and display the AI-generated responses.

Results

The integration of AI prompts significantly improved the chatbot’s performance:

  • Personalization: The chatbot now provides personalized responses based on the user’s query and history.
  • Efficiency: The chatbot can handle a higher volume of queries without compromising on response quality.
  • Scalability: The system is designed to scale as the user base grows.

Table: Comparison of ChatBotCo’s Chatbot Before and After AI Prompt Integration

Aspect Before Integration After Integration
Personalization Limited, generic responses High, context-aware responses
Efficiency Handles low query volumes Handles high query volumes
Scalability Limited scalability High scalability
User Feedback Mixed, some users dissatisfied Positive, improved user ratings
APIPark is a high-performance AI gateway that allows you to securely access the most comprehensive LLM APIs globally on the APIPark platform, including OpenAI, Anthropic, Mistral, Llama2, Google Gemini, and more.Try APIPark now! 👇👇👇

Overcoming Challenges

Integrating AI prompts into messaging services is not without its challenges. Here are some common issues and how to address them:

Challenge 1: Ensuring Data Privacy

AI prompts often involve handling sensitive user data. Ensuring data privacy is crucial.

  • Solution: Implement robust security measures, including encryption and access controls, to protect user data.

Challenge 2: Handling Model Errors

AI models can sometimes produce incorrect or irrelevant responses.

  • Solution: Implement fallback strategies and provide users with the option to provide feedback on the chatbot’s responses.

Challenge 3: Scaling the Solution

As user demand grows, scaling the AI prompt integration can become challenging.

  • Solution: Use a scalable AI Gateway like APIPark to manage increased loads and ensure consistent performance.

Best Practices for Successful Integration

To ensure a successful integration of AI prompts into messaging services, here are some best practices:

  1. Start Small: Begin with a pilot project to test the integration and gather feedback before scaling up.
  2. User-Centric Design: Focus on the user experience throughout the integration process.
  3. Continuous Monitoring: Regularly monitor the performance of the AI prompts and make necessary adjustments.
  4. Training and Support: Provide training and support for users and developers to ensure smooth adoption of the new features.

The Role of APIPark in AI Prompt Integration

APIPark plays a crucial role in the integration of AI prompts into messaging services. Its features, such as quick integration of AI models, unified API format, and end-to-end API lifecycle management, make it an ideal choice for businesses looking to enhance their messaging services with AI capabilities.

Key Features of APIPark:

  • Quick Integration: APIPark allows for the quick integration of over 100 AI models, making it easy to find the right model for your messaging service.
  • Unified API Format: It provides a unified API format for AI invocation, ensuring that changes in AI models or prompts do not affect the application code.
  • End-to-End API Lifecycle Management: APIPark helps manage the entire lifecycle of APIs, from design to decommission, ensuring seamless integration and operation.

Conclusion

Integrating AI prompts into messaging services represents a significant opportunity to enhance user engagement. By leveraging tools like AI Gateway, LLM Gateway, and OpenAPI, businesses can create more personalized and efficient messaging experiences. APIPark, with its robust features and ease of use, can streamline this integration process, making it accessible even to non-technical teams.

FAQs

Q1: How can AI prompts improve user engagement in messaging services?

AI prompts can provide more personalized and context-aware responses, making interactions more engaging and relevant to the user's needs.

Q2: What is the role of an AI Gateway in integrating AI prompts?

An AI Gateway acts as a middleware that connects various AI services and models to the user interface, abstracting the complexity and providing a unified interface for developers.

Q3: How does APIPark help in integrating AI prompts into messaging services?

APIPark offers features like quick integration of AI models, unified API format, and end-to-end API lifecycle management, making it easier to integrate AI prompts into messaging services.

Q4: What are the challenges in integrating AI prompts into messaging services?

Challenges include ensuring data privacy, handling model errors, and scaling the solution to handle increased loads.

Q5: What are the best practices for successful integration of AI prompts?

Best practices include starting small with a pilot project, focusing on user-centric design, continuous monitoring, and providing training and support for users and developers.

🚀You can securely and efficiently call the OpenAI API on APIPark in just two steps:

Step 1: Deploy the APIPark AI gateway in 5 minutes.

APIPark is developed based on Golang, offering strong product performance and low development and maintenance costs. You can deploy APIPark with a single command line.

curl -sSO https://download.apipark.com/install/quick-start.sh; bash quick-start.sh
APIPark Command Installation Process

In my experience, you can see the successful deployment interface within 5 to 10 minutes. Then, you can log in to APIPark using your account.

APIPark System Interface 01

Step 2: Call the OpenAI API.

APIPark System Interface 02

Learn more